Default whole 30/paleo shortcuts?

We're on day 20 something of whole 30 (the good thing is that I've lost track of what day we're on!). It's good for sure. But it's a lot of work. A lot of food prep and a lot of dish washing. I have to do 100% of it, as dh is taking classes and working. I'm overwhelmed and feeling stressed. I would love to keep up a similar eating lifestyle, but I can't keep up with this much work in the kitchen. Nothing is fast.

Tonight, while the chicken part of the dinner is fast, I had to grate cauliflower just to make "cauli-rice," which wasn't even good! I miss being able to just pull rice out of the pantry to make.

I know some of you have done this long term. What short cuts do you have? How to you make this more efficient?

I kept/keep food packs in the freezer. I cut a meal sized portion of protein, throw in some frozen veggies and onions etc and put in a ziplock. That way I could just toss it in the pan and cook quick. No cutting, chopping etc. I didn't do anything like cauli rice etc. too much work and it's just not worth it. It will never be the same.

Roast veggies in coconut oil or olive oil and lots of garlic. Especially cruciferous veggies. So good. Not boring. Very hands off. I use a big stone bar pan for mine and it takes almost no prep time and I just rinse and wipe the pan clean .
Saute your rice after you use a blender or food processor, or skip it and put the food over spinach instead.

And really, I find making salad quicker with less prep and clean up then most other meals.

I am not super up on Whole30 and what ways of cooking are allowed...but could you put meat and veggies in the crock pot? I'm not sure what spices are allowed but you can do some great dry rubs with some munched garlic on meat and throw in Brussels sprouts or other veggies (I get big bags of Brussels sprouts from Costco and even put them alone in crockpot with garlic and balsamic vinegar and cook on low for several hours and they are delicious). I just think a veggie, a meat (whole chickens are great in crockpot too) thrown in crockpot and cooked slow with some minced garlic is easy and the juices from the meat add flavor to the veggies

I am a huge fan of my crockpot and use it a LOT

I don't really know anything about wholefoods 30 BUT I have been on a whole foods diet for 5 years of my own making, which sounds very similar to this diet. So ignore if any of my suggestions don't match up.

As a rice or pasta substitute, our hands down fave is julienne cut zucchini noodles. Only takes a few minutes to slice up. Either raw (my fave), or lightly sauteed with coconut oil (dh's fave). Our 2nd choice is spaghetti squash. Even easier. Cut in half, scoop out seeds and throw in the oven.

I also recently took a chicken and veggie stir fry and served it over a bed of raw spinach and it was DELICIOUS! The warm topping warming up the raw spinach just made for a melt in my mouth fireworks of deliciousness. (Yes, I'm fairly in love with delicious food ).

---------- Post added at 09:43 AM ---------- Previous post was at 09:30 AM ----------

As for meats, we add a good rotation of a variety of wild caught fish to our diet. That adds a plethora of options.

Wild caught sockeye salmon is our absolute favourite. Broiled or grilled. Super quick and easy. From the package to the dinner table in less than 30 minutes. We also have a variety of other fish in our rotation depending on what the local grocery stores have in stock/on sale that are wild caught.

But back to the chicken... Since that tends to be our most regularly used meat too here for simplicity and price. Keeping variety... Do you try different cuts? I use a ton of boneless skinless breasts, however, I also add in other cuts depending on what I'm making. I find that the kids prefer the boneless skinless thighs because the higher fat content makes them juicier. I also use the thighs regularly in crock pot dishes that the meat cooks down and gets shredded. Of course chicken quarters are also a regular rotation here. Grilled is our fave but oven roasted is also delicious. A roasted whole chicken is a nice variety change too.

It looks like you can do coconut milk on the whole 30 -- have you ever made chicken curry? Totally delicious and something my dh could eat every day.

We love cauliflower rice, but I use lots of coconut oil and salt, and it always has a sauce on it. Roasted veggies, again lots of olive or coconut oil and salt. Chicken over cauliflower rice with canned coconut milk on top is yummy

Chicken "breaded" in a mix of coconut flour and almond flour and fried over cauliflower rice with a sauce made from oj pineapple chunks and peppers and coconut aminos is good.

Spaghetti with meatballs over zucchini noodles.

Hamburgers with lettuce buns.

It's hard, i couldn't keep up after the 30 days.
